Wilson Christian Academy can now show off six landslide victories after their most recent game on Friday. They were the clear victor by a 14-1 margin over the Southside Christian Warriors. The win was nothing new for Wilson Christian Academy as they're now sitting on three straight.
Parker Bunn made a splash while hitting and pitching. On the mound, he didn't allow a single earned run and only one hit over five innings pitched. Bunn was also solid in the batter's box, going 4-for-4 with a stolen base and a double.
In other batting news, Gunner Williams was excellent, scoring three runs and stealing a base while going 2-for-2. He has been hot recently, having posted at least one stolen base the last three times he's played. Another player making a difference was Dawson Carnes, who scored three runs and stole a base while going 1-for-1.
On Southside Christian's side, they saw two different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Jason Burke, who went 1-for-2 with a double.
Wilson Christian Academy's victory bumped their record up to 7-5. As for Southside Christian, their defeat dropped their record down to 5-5.
Wilson Christian Academy will head out on the road to take on American Leadership Academy-Johnston at 4:30 p.m. on Monday. American Leadership Academy-Johnston is on a three-game streak of home wins, Wilson Christian Academy a eight-game streak of away wins (dating back to last season)-- so someone will have to leave a streak behind on the field. As for Southside Christian, they will head out on the road to challenge Liberty Christian at 4:00 p.m. on Monday. Southside Christian is facing Liberty Christian at the right time seeing as Liberty Christian is stuck on a six-game losing streak.
